Host George Edelman welcomes Ed Solomon to share how lessons from both success and failure\u2014along with one wild night at an Alaskan Strip Club\u2014have had a hand in shaping the writer he is today.\xa0\xa0\n\nIn this episode, we talk about\u2026\n\nHow Ed\u2019s high school experience inspired him to be a writer and why he tells himself he\u2019s an imposter daily\n\nHow shifting from big budget films to smaller specs expanded Ed\u2019s creative path\n\nHow a trip to an Alaskan strip club led Ed to write the play \u201cStrip Club\u201d and how it got him hired for Laverne & Shirley\xa0\n\nThe fallacy about gateways that lead to your career\u2014you make your own path\n\nWhy Ed considers Men in Black as a series of failures that culminated in success\xa0\n\nDeveloping a skill set to learn how to write while you write and learning from every script\xa0\xa0\n\nHow Ed approaches storytelling:\xa0\n\nRemember you\u2019re always dealing with point of view even if you don\u2019t realize it\n\nKnow what it means to have a healthy relationship with the audience and always keep in mind what they know\n\nExamples of objective vs. subjective points of view\xa0\n\nConsider your audience as a friendly ally\xa0\n\nAdvice for new writers:\xa0\n\nGet other people to say your words out loud and listen to it\n\nTake your words and mount it, direct it, film it, edit it\xa0\n\nTake acting, editing, and cinematography classes\xa0\n\nWatch your very favorite movies and transcribe them\u2014internalize what those writers did\n\nWhat you can learn from transcribing films:\xa0\n\nHow little dialogue you actually need\n\nHow little stage direction you need\xa0\n\nHow short scenes are and how they do not have a beginning, middle and end but just a middle (usually)\n\nThe importance of sequences and how things are a juxtaposition of little pieces to form a sequence\xa0\n\nYou really only learn about writing screenplays by writing a bunch of screenplays\xa0\n\nWhy Ed is choosing to keep a beginner\u2019s mind until the end\xa0\n\n\n\nLinks to Resources:\nNo Sudden Move on HBO max\n\nSubscribe to our newsletter for news, contests, deals, and a FREE ebook at https://nofilmschool.com/screenwritingbook.\xa0\n\nCheck out our new video on lighting night shoots: https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=J66WWsCp7XE\n\xa0\nYou can read about all this and more at https://nofilmschool.com/.
